Day-ahead market / August 27, 2021
Daily price overview
For Sweden SE1 on August 27, 2021, the time-weighted day-ahead average is 4.91 ct/kWh.
The lowest interval is 4.21 ct/kWh at 02:00–03:00, while the highest is 5.22 ct/kWh at 10:00–11:00. The difference between the day’s low and high is 1.01 ct/kWh.
The lowest-cost continuous three-hour window runs from 01:00 to 04:00 and averages 4.23 ct/kWh. The highest-cost three-hour window is 08:00–11:00 at 5.19 ct/kWh, a difference of 0.96 ct/kWh in the wholesale component. For market-linked plans, these are useful periods to inspect when scheduling flexible consumption.
No delivery interval is priced below zero on this day.
